New house for sale near Byala

This is an amazing, new, two-story house, finished in 2010. The house has total living area of 140 sq m and a yard of 715 sq m.

The property is situated 35 km away from Varna on the main road Varna-Burgas. It is only 8 km from the resorts of Byala and Obzor and the famous eco-beach Karadere.

The distribution of the premises inside the house is the following:

First floor - 3 bedrooms, bathroom with toilet and a bathtub.

Second floor - living room with dining area, furnished kitchen, bathroom and toilet, laundry room. There is also a working fireplace.

The yard is planted with many flowers, shrubs, and the most important advantage - a swimming pool.

The village is clean with very good infrastructure, shops, small restaurants, church, kindergarten, town hall, medical center, petrol station and regular transport from and to Varna. The area offers safari excursions, buggy tournaments, a zoo and much else.
